Resumo: In the wake of the COVID-19 pandemic, the active tourism sector is facing a huge challenge to adapt its activities to comply with a host of new regulations and protection measures against the spread of the virus. This study consists of a documentary review and analysis of the legislative, institutional and sectoral regulations, recommendations, proposals and protocols introduced to deal with the situation in Spain. The reactivation of the sector requires new measures to avoid infection, including restrictions on the number and type of participants, interpersonal distance, space management, disinfection, protection barriers, modification of activities and customer guidance. Revival strategies include the promotion of synergies and consensus between the different bodies affected by the crisis to agree measures for the promotion, market readjustment and operational management of tourism activities, together with regulations, recommendations and methodologies for the design of protocols and contingency plans to deal with a multitude of possible scenarios.
